*Greetings from the Critique Club*
My first impression of this is the interesting effect you've gone for with the almost pencil-like finish. As mentioned in one of the comments you received, it does in a way remind you of a Geiger drawing. The subject you have gone for is unique to say the least.
I think where this photo suffered the most was in the voters perceptions of the blown highlights. In a way it blends with the pencil effect so therefore in my opinion it doesn't distract too much from the overall image.
You've kept most of the important detail in the arm and hand which is most important and both the foreground of the cables and the background of the hand sit nicely in focus.
Overall this is a really good effort and very unique. Well done on your placing and best of luck in future challenges.
